The Adjustment Bar
The Adjustment Bar allows quick access to the settings most 
commonly changed while using the unit. The Adjustment Bar 
settings are: Range, Gain, Scroll, Zoom, and View. 
Press the MENU key to view the current Adjustment Bar settings. 
Press MENU again to hide the window. The current adjustment 
option always appears in the upper left of the display. Press left or 
right on the Arrow keys to scroll through the available options.
To immediately change the current adjustment option, press the 
up 
or down Arrow key. To review the available settings before making 
a change, press the ENTER key to activate the adjustment window.
To change a setting on the unit:
1.  Press 
MENU, use the up or down Arrow key.
2.  Move the selection arrow to the option you want, and press 
ENTER
3.  Choose 
Setup for the main Setup Menu.
Range
Sets the display depth range. The unit can automatically 
track the bottom, or be set to a user-specified range. 
Available settings are: Auto (default) or 5-900 ft.
Gain
Controls the sensitivity of the unit’s sonar receiver. This 
provides some flexibility in what is seen on the display. 
To see more detail, increase the receiver sensitivity by 
selecting a higher gain (+). If there is too much detail 
or if the screen is cluttered, lowering the sensitivity (-) 
may increase the clarity of the display. Available settings are: Auto 
(default) and 0-100%. The Auto setting level is controlled by the 
Auto Gain setting in the Setup menu.
Scroll
Adjusts the rate that the graph scrolls from right to left. 
If you are sitting still or the graph is moving too fast, 
slowing or pausing the graph can be beneficial.
